African University of Science and Technology (AUST)
Development of a mixed-use campus facility on a 20,000 square meter site, comprising:
- Hostel Accommodation – 500-room student housing complex
- Guest House – 100-room facility for visiting faculty, guests, and dignitaries
- Business & Food Court – Commercial complex housing 50 office units alongside dining and retail outlets
- Event Center – Multi-purpose venue with a seating capacity of 1,500
This integrated development is designed to enhance campus life by combining residential, commercial, and event infrastructure within a single, cohesive masterplan.
Nigerian Shippers’ Council
Development of Vehicle Transit Areas (VTAs) and Inland Dry Ports across four states:
- Ogun State
- Edo State
- Kogi State
- Plateau State
This initiative supports the Council’s mandate to decongest seaports, streamline cargo evacuation, and improve logistics efficiency by establishing strategic inland transit and trade facilitation hubs across key transport corridors.

United Ghana Universities Staff Superannuation Scheme (UGUSSS)
Construction and development of purpose-built hostel accommodation across nine public universities in Ghana, delivered under the United Ghana Universities Staff Superannuation Scheme (UGUSSS).
This programm represents a coordinated institutional investment in student housing infrastructure, addressing the growing accommodation deficit across Ghana’s higher education sector. The development spans nine university campuses, delivering standardized yet campus-appropriate residential facilities designed to support student welfare, improve academic retention, and modernize the living standards of university communities nationwide.

Construction & Financing of the National Olympic Stadium
A flagship infrastructure development for the National Olympic Committee of Togo (CNO-T), this project focuses on the financing, design, and construction of a world-class National Olympic Stadium integrated within a modern Olympic Smart City.
The development is envisioned as a multi-purpose destination that promotes sports excellence, sustainable urban development, and economic growth while providing world-class facilities for athletes, residents, visitors, and the wider community.
Project Highlights
Olympic Stadium – International-standard venue for sporting events, ceremonies, concerts, and national celebrations.
Administrative Facilities – Headquarters and office spaces for the National Olympic Committee, sports federations, and event management.
Sports Facilities – Training centres, indoor arenas, athletics tracks, football pitches, aquatic facilities, and multi-purpose courts.
Residential Development – Athlete accommodation, residential apartments, and hospitality facilities.
Healthcare Services – Sports medicine centre, rehabilitation facilities, emergency care, and wellness services.
Transport & Smart Mobility – Smart roads, public transport integration, parking, pedestrian walkways, and sustainable mobility solutions.
Recreational Amenities – Parks, green spaces, retail outlets, restaurants, entertainment areas, and community sports facilities.
The Olympic Smart City is designed to position Togo as a leading destination for international sporting events while creating lasting social, economic, and tourism benefits for the nation.
